Ortuella: Geographical Location and Climate

Ortuella is situated in northern Spain, within the Basque Country’s Province of Biscay. It lies just a short distance from Bilbao, the region’s capital, which makes it an excellent base for exploring both rural and urban landscapes. Ortuella is located inland but is close to the Bay of Biscay, offering easy access to beautiful beaches like Playa de Sopelana and the natural reserves that surround it. The nearby Serantes mountain adds a dramatic backdrop to the city, providing ample opportunities for outdoor activities and nature exploration.

The city enjoys a temperate oceanic climate, characterized by mild winters and pleasant summers. Rain is fairly frequent, especially in the autumn and winter months, which contributes to the region’s lush, green environment. The best time to visit Ortuella is during the late spring and early summer (May to July), when the weather is mild, and outdoor activities like hiking and beach visits are most enjoyable. September is also a lovely time for cultural festivals and events.

Its proximity to Bilbao also makes Ortuella an ideal location for day trips to other scenic spots, such as the Basque coastline, the Urdaibai Biosphere Reserve, and the dramatic cliffs of the Flysch Route.
